compassx - Group - Sr. Figma Design System Specialist
Requirements
• Expert-level Figma proficiency: You know the platform deeply, including how files, libraries, components, variants, and publishing workflows interact. • Hands-on library management: Experience managing or rebuilding Figma shared libraries. You understand how library changes propagate and what breaks when they don’t. • Design Token architecture: Strong working knowledge of design token architecture—how tokens are structured, how they map to Figma variables and styles, and how to validate connections. • Figma Swap Library: Direct experience using Figma’s Swap Library feature in a real-world enterprise context, not just experimenting with it. • System Auditing: Ability to audit large, complex Figma file systems and identify structural dependencies without being told where to look. • Detail-oriented & Methodical: Comfort doing high-volume, precise reconnection work where mistakes have severe downstream consequences. • Self-sufficient: You can take an ambiguous brief and run with it day-to-day without needing constant direction. • Token Studio experience: Setup, configuration, multi-brand token sets, and direct connection to Figma variables. • Figma Enterprise Tier Administration: Understanding of org settings, team structure, seat management, and library sharing settings. • Migration Playbook Execution: Prior work on a design system migration, brand split, or Figma org transition. • Multi-brand Design Systems: Understanding how a shared foundation gets forked into brand-specific implementations. • You’ve done this exact task before, moved a Figma environment from one enterprise account to another and know where the bodies are buried. • Figma plugin knowledge relevant to library management, bulk operations, or token tooling. • Comfortable presenting complex technical findings and architectural decisions to design leadership in plain language. • ## Context & Environment • You’ll work alongside internal design teams who are actively in production throughout the migration. • Two additional Technical Figma Designers will join the engagement in month one and carry execution work through month three. You’ll help orient them and keep the work sequenced. • The migration is highly time-sensitive with external deadlines. • This is not a role where you’ll be told exactly what to do. We need someone who can assess the environment, identify the right approach, and execute with absolute precision.
Responsibilities
• Audit Figma workspace files and map the shared library dependencies, component references, and token connections across Patterns, Recipes, Templates, and working files. • Lead the duplication and restructuring of the Foundations library into a brand-specific version—stripping non-applicable assets while maintaining component naming integrity. • Execute Figma’s Swap Library feature across the full file set to reconnect components after the Foundations library is re-homed in the new account. • Identify and manually resolve any components that cannot be automatically matched during the swap—including renamed, deleted, or structurally changed assets. • Validate the published state of all Patterns, Recipes, and Template libraries post-migration to ensure all downstream files are receiving updates correctly. • Document all library decisions, known gaps, and structural changes for the ongoing design team. • Set up Token Studio in the new Figma account and connect it to a brand-specific token set. • Validate that all token connections are intact post-migration—colors, typography, spacing, and component-level tokens. • Identify and resolve broken or mismatched token references across migrated files. • Ensure the token architecture supports an independent design system going forward. • Run a proof of concept test early in the engagement: duplicate a low-lift team, transfer it to a test workspace within a provided sandbox, and repeat for a library file documenting findings before full migration begins. • Coordinate with org admins on the team-level transfer to the new Enterprise account. • Work through the migration in a sequenced order that minimizes disruption to active design work. • QA the full migrated environment before handoff confirming no broken references, missing libraries, or disconnected tokens remain.
